# Java 曲线平滑实现
## 简介
在 Java 中实现曲线平滑是一个常见的需求,可以用于图表的绘制、图像的处理等场景。本文将介绍一种常用的方法来实现 Java 曲线的平滑处理。
## 流程
下面是实现 Java 曲线平滑的一般流程,可以用表格的形式展示:
| 步骤 | 描述 |
| --- | --- |
| 1. | 获取曲线的数据 |
| 2. | 对数据进行平滑处理 |
| 3.
原创
2023-07-19 08:37:52
551阅读
<%@ page language="java" contentType="image/jpeg;charset=GBK"
import="java.awt.*, java.awt.image.*, com.sun.image.codec.jpeg.*"%>
<%
// 在內存中创建图像
int width = 600;
int height = 500;
Buffe
转载
2023-06-14 21:22:43
188阅读
最近需要将数据通过图表展示出来,以便观察其变化趋势。直接展示出来的效果不是很好,故在网上查找了很久曲线平滑的方法,最终找到了了一套比较适合的方法,思路比较简单,对于现在的项目来说效果也还不错,故记录一下。原始数据大小分别为881、490和1711,直接展示如下图所示: 原始曲线
由于采集过程中传感器数据变化比较敏感,所以有比较明显的锯齿,故第一步需要去差值。这里采用的是“五点去差值
转载
2024-06-25 07:07:20
705阅读
在Photoshop中,我们通常会应用曲线调节图层来更改曲线。在PS中图层面板的右下方,第四图标便是“创建调节图层”选择项,点开后确定“曲线”,我们就能够创建个“曲线调节图层”。创建调节图层,而并非在原图层上立即更改曲线。优势便是能够使我们方便快捷的撤销/恢复所做的随意调节。曲线是啥?这篇文章将重中之重讲解RGB通道曲线,这是由红(R)绿(G)蓝(B)三个通道的曲线堆叠而成的,能够“
转载
2024-09-30 12:56:08
24阅读
# Java平滑曲线算法实现指南
## 一、整体流程
为了帮助你理解Java平滑曲线算法的实现过程,我将整个过程分为以下几个步骤,并将每个步骤所需的代码和说明列出。
### 步骤表格: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 准备数据 |
| 2 | 计算控制点 |
| 3 | 生成平滑曲线 |
## 二、具体操作
### 步骤一:准备数据
在实现平滑曲线
原创
2024-03-08 03:43:14
499阅读
# Java曲线平滑算法
曲线平滑是一种在数据可视化中常用的技术,它可以帮助我们更清晰地看到数据的趋势,减少噪声的影响。在Java中,实现曲线平滑算法的方法有很多,本文将介绍一种常用的方法——移动平均法。
## 移动平均法
移动平均法是一种简单有效的曲线平滑算法。它通过计算数据点的局部平均值来平滑曲线。具体来说,对于一个数据序列,我们可以计算每个数据点的前n个数据点的平均值,然后将这个平均值
原创
2024-07-26 04:53:56
150阅读
Lecture 3 + Lecture 4 + Lecture 5 目录Lecture 3 + Lecture 4 + Lecture 5车辆运动模型及SL坐标系SL坐标系下曲线平滑度的要求用Smoothing Spline生成平滑曲线Spline 2D二次规划与牛顿法二次规划 QP 车辆运动模型及SL坐标系运动模型为Ackermann模型,即自行车模型;SL坐标系即Frenet坐标系。模型和坐
转载
2023-11-25 10:54:06
320阅读
# 如何实现JavaScript曲线平滑
## 引言
在JavaScript开发中,实现曲线平滑是一项常见的需求。曲线平滑可以让图表或动画更加美观,同时也有助于提高用户体验。本文旨在教会刚入行的小白如何实现JavaScript曲线平滑。
## 实现流程
首先,让我们来整理一下实现曲线平滑的流程。可以使用以下表格展示每个步骤:
| 步骤 | 描述 |
| ---- | ---- |
| 步骤1
原创
2023-12-19 08:52:04
269阅读
Ardupilot前馈及平滑函数input_euler_angle_roll_pitch_yaw解析源码解析这个函数做了什么部分细节euler_accel_limit()input_shaping_angle()姿态变化率与机体角速度之间的关系 本文将以input_euler_angle_roll_pitch_yaw()函数为例,讲解一下APM中的前馈及平滑控制函数,当然其余的类似input_
转载
2024-09-19 15:19:45
162阅读
信号采集是非常常见的需求,我们也总是希望采集到的数据是纯净而真实的,但这只是我们的希望。环境中存在太多的干扰信号,为了让我们得到的数据尽可能地接近实际值,我们需要降低这些干扰信号的影响,于是就有了滤波器的用武之地。这里我们讨论的主要是软件实现的数字滤波器,这一篇我们就来讨论基于递推算术平均算法的平滑滤波器。1、问题的提出在我们通过AD采集获取数据时,不可避免会受到干扰信号的影响,而且很多时候我们希
转载
2024-07-10 22:20:04
76阅读
# Python曲线平滑实现指南
## 概述
在开发过程中,曲线平滑是一个常见的需求。本文将教你如何使用Python实现曲线平滑,帮助你在项目中更好地处理曲线数据。
## 实现流程
以下是实现曲线平滑的步骤:
```mermaid
erDiagram
确定需求 --> 数据采集
数据采集 --> 数据处理
数据处理 --> 曲线平滑
曲线平滑 --> 结果展示
原创
2024-02-27 06:41:00
526阅读
安卓平滑曲线在UI设计和用户体验中是一个核心概念,旨在优化用户交互时的视觉感受。平滑曲线不仅影响用户的视觉体验,也关乎应用的整体性能。本文将逐步阐述如何在安卓环境中解决“安卓平滑曲线”问题,包括准备环节到性能优化的各个步骤。
### 环境准备
在开始之前,我们需要确保我们的技术栈与安卓项目的兼容性。以下是我们的技术栈兼容性分析:
```mermaid
quadrantChart
ti
# 平滑曲线的Python实现
## 引言
在数据可视化和图形处理领域,平滑曲线的应用非常广泛。平滑曲线可以帮助我们更清晰地理解数据的趋势,过滤掉噪音,甚至为机器学习模型的训练提供更优质的数据。本文将介绍如何在Python中实现平滑曲线,主要使用NumPy和Matplotlib库,并提供具体的代码示例。
## 什么是平滑曲线?
平滑曲线是对一组离散数据的平滑近似,一般通过对数据进行插值、拟
实际上类似的曲线可以做很多,参考Benice的博客(或者此处上一篇博客转发的少量图片),但是这个五角星形状的曲线比较简单。我从来只是把网络上BBS或博客之类的写的东西当作一种消遣而不是研究,所以,不能指望对文字内容从语法上严格推敲,除非很有兴趣也不太可能过问对我来说太艰涩繁复又非自己必须做的事情。——除非有合法而可观的佣金圆圆相切的情况下谋点运动轨迹的描述,通过调整参数可以作出各种曲线,如果仔细研
本篇也主要基于参考二翻译而来,背景是因为 GPIR代码 里有这层做初始化,不太懂怎么干的和干啥,所以就搜索了一下,一开始一直在弄参考三使其能逐步断点debug 以让我能明了整个步骤,不过后来搜了一下看到了参考二 emm 就是我想要了解的 smooth到底是怎样编程二次规划问题的。以下大部分翻译至参考二,其中添加了自己的思考句子(有时也可能就是问题实际这个包的名字就:QP-Spline-Path O
众所周知想用canvas画一条曲线我们可以使用这些函数:二次曲线:quadraticCurveTo(cp1x, cp1y, x, y)贝塞尔曲线:bezierCurveTo(cp1x, cp1y, cp2x, cp2y, x, y)画圆弧:arcTo(x1,y1,x2,y2,radius);但是如果一组点给你,怎么通过这些已知点画一条平滑的曲线呢?使用二次曲线,或是圆弧?恐怕这些都没法满足曲线多变
转载
2023-12-03 16:47:46
112阅读
由于高频某些点的波动导致高频曲线非常难看,为了降低噪声干扰,需要对曲线做平滑处理,让曲线过渡更平滑。常见的对曲线进行平滑处理的方法包括: Savitzky-Golay 滤波器、插值法等。Savitzky-Golay 滤波器:对曲线进行平滑处理,通过Savitzky-Golay 滤波器,可以在scipy库里直接调用,不需要再定义函数。
转载
2023-10-21 21:04:07
18阅读
题目来源于:南京师范大学韦玉春教授慕课国家精品课《遥感数字图像处理》程序设计建议 如何将OpenCV配置在IDEA中自行百度 环境:win10+IDEA2021.2.3+jdk11.0.1+OpenCV-460.jar一、简介背景: 高斯低通滤波是图像平滑算法的一种,在图像产生、传输和复制过程中,常常会因为多方面原因被噪声干扰或出现数据丢失,降低了图像的质量,需要对图像进行一定
转载
2023-12-20 08:56:30
99阅读
一幅原始图像在获取和传输过程中会受到各种噪声的干扰,使图像质量下降,对分析图像不利。反映到画面上,主要有两种典型的噪声。一种是幅值基本相同,但出现的位置很随机的椒盐噪声。另一种则每一点都存在,但幅值随机分布的随机噪声。为了抑制噪声、改善图像质量,要对图像进行平滑处理。几种常见的噪声 图像常常被强度随机信号(也称为噪声)所污染.一些常见的噪声有椒盐(Salt&am
转载
2024-01-04 20:17:42
93阅读
目标 • 学习使用不同的低通滤波器对图像进行模糊 • 使用自定义的滤波器对图像进行卷积(2D 卷积)与信号一样,我们也可以对2D 图像实施低通滤波(LPF),高通滤波 (HPF)等。LPF 帮助我们去除噪音,模糊图像。HPF 帮助我们找到图像的边 缘,OpenCV 提供的函数cv.filter2D() 可以让我们对一幅图像进行卷积操 作。下面我们将对一幅图像使用平均滤波器。下面是一个5x5 的平均
转载
2024-03-23 11:18:13
100阅读